GENDREAU, Charles (Chuck) E.

Chuck passed away peacefully, November 19th at the age of 80 years, with his children by his side, following a courageous battle with cancer. Chuck is survived by his children Denise (Tom) DeSorcy, Michele (Dwayne) Thornhill, Anthony (Kathy) Gendreau and Geoff Gendreau; grandchildren, Mike(Kyliane), Sara DeSorcy, Aysa Thornhill and great grandson, Keaton Gendreau, as well as by many siblings in Ontario. Chuck was born in Windsor to a very large (11 siblings) family. He joined the military where he served for 32 years. His career took him and his family throughout many places in Canada and Europe. Following retirement, dad made beautiful Hope, BC his home where he lived for the past 23 years. Chuck enjoyed sports throughout his adult life from baseball to hockey to curling. He was an avid golfer and long-time member of the Hope Golf Club. When not golfing, he enjoyed camping and spending time with family. He will be forever missed by his children, grandchildren and great grandchild as well as the many friends whose lives he touched.
